Output 23120f14ab3b7509de47f4958e79d9ec021a0351a422a2019ee1167a071f8673:1

value
45254368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a59c4a8ac3eb165f0bf24c61e03913a3b443ec4 OP_EQUAL
address
MEgHmq4U3McP4btRhsKFSVqdcCpg214YFz
transaction
23120f14ab3b7509de47f4958e79d9ec021a0351a422a2019ee1167a071f8673
spent
true